Transaction f5cc32131534bcf9d8d7d1581c4978d1b40707d76a1446447c9622a7e54a7263

1 Input
2 Outputs
  • f5cc32131534bcf9d8d7d1581c4978d1b40707d76a1446447c9622a7e54a7263:0
  • value  4000000
    address  33egxZYgcKjLeNCY6i2nDzjhEjf1xQmwUj
  • f5cc32131534bcf9d8d7d1581c4978d1b40707d76a1446447c9622a7e54a7263:1
  • value  66656924
    address  3NZuxGGG5ppMKmjZEjJzu5s9c1DwNGoevP